I can't decide whether I am going to love or loathe...but I'll defo be watching!!

Lord of the Flies is one of my favourite books and this seems (so far) to be a pretty goo contemporary version...complete with transparent metaphors for society norms, prejudices, etc AND a 'beast' in the jungle. In the book it turns out to be a wild boar...don't think a wild boar could yank out said pilot and leave in a tree...

Someone mentioned Jurassic Park...is it going to turn out to be some secret experiment with massive beasts that have then killed all the scientists living there (16yrs ago?)...

I hope not...
